(አዲስ ልሳን ጋዜጣ) stands as a foundational pillars of municipal journalism and local storytelling in Ethiopia. Published primarily in Amharic—the official working language of the federal government and a dominant lingua franca—the newspaper has served as the key bridge between the local government administration and the millions of residents inhabiting the country’s capital city, Addis Ababa.

Government institutions, municipal desks, and partnering regional entities utilize the newspaper to publish . Organizations like the Addis Ababa City Administration Land Development and Administration Bureau systematically post bidding parameters and lease closing notifications within its print boundaries. For businesses, legal teams, and developers operating within the Ethiopian market, checking Addis Lisan is often a structural requirement for discovering public commercial opportunities. As the official newspaper of the Addis Ababa City Administration, it has served as a direct line of communication between the city's government and its millions of residents for decades. While it may not have the national daily circulation of publications like Addis Zemen , Addis Lisan 's role as a conduit for local governance, public announcements, and city-specific news has made it an indispensable institution in the Ethiopian capital.
